#ab612c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ab612c is composed of 67.1% red, 38%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 43.3% magenta, 74.3%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 25 degrees, a saturation of 59.1% and a lightness of 42.2%. #ab612c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c258 with #570000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#ab612c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0904 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#ab612c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#716b66 is the less saturated color, while #d45a03 is the most saturated one.
